AI Summary

  • Requires municipalities to apportion property tax assessment appeal refunds among the municipality, county, school districts, fire districts, and other taxing districts based on their pro rata share.

  • Municipal tax collectors must notify county, school districts, fire districts, and other taxing districts of their proportionate share of refunds paid during the tax year for inclusion in subsequent annual budgets.

  • In the year following refund payments, municipal tax collectors will deduct each entity's pro rata share from the amounts otherwise payable to counties, school districts, and fire districts.

  • Currently, only counties share the burden of property tax appeal refunds with municipalities through the county tax equalization process; this bill expands that responsibility to school and fire districts.

  • The bill takes effect immediately upon enactment.

Legislative Description

Requires fire districts, school districts, and county governments to share in burden of property assessment appeal refunds.
